.hero-block{position:relative;display:flex;flex-direction:column;align-items:center;margin-top:90px}.hero-block__background{display:none}.hero-block__videoplayer{width:100%}.hero-block__content{position:absolute;top:22%;left:50%;display:flex;flex-direction:column;align-items:center;width:38%;padding:0 40px;text-align:center;transform:translateX(-50%)}.hero-block__title{margin-bottom:20px;color:#36486a;font-family:Gotham Medium;font-size:26px;font-weight:500;line-height:32px;text-transform:uppercase}.hero-block__description{color:#36486a;font-size:18px;text-align:center;margin-bottom:20px}.videoplayer_big{display:block}.videoplayer_medium,.videoplayer_small{display:none}.fadeIn{opacity:1}@media screen and (max-width:1640px){.hero-block__content{width:45%}}@media screen and (max-width:1400px){.hero-block__content{top:18%;width:50%}}@media screen and (max-width:1280px){.hero-block__content{width:60%}.videoplayer_big{display:none}.videoplayer_medium{display:block}}@media screen and (max-width:992px){.hero-block__content{top:12%;width:80%}}@media screen and (max-width:640px){.hero-block__content{width:100%;top:12%}.hero-block__title{font-size:16px;line-height:22px;margin-bottom:14px}.hero-block__description{font-size:14px;margin-bottom:12px}.videoplayer_medium{display:none}.videoplayer_small{display:block}}@media screen and (max-width:430px){.videoplayer_small{display:none}.hero-block__content{width:100%;padding:0 16px;top:20%}.hero-block__title{font-size:16px;line-height:22px}.hero-block__description{font-size:12px}.hero-block__background{width:100%;height:590px;display:block;background-image:url(/_next/static/media/mobile_hero.2d4c204d.svg);background-position:50% 100%}}.card{display:flex;flex-direction:column;justify-content:space-between;align-items:start;min-height:230px;padding:32px 0 32px 32px;border-radius:12px;background-color:#f6f8fc;transition:all .3s ease-in}.card:hover{transform:scale(1.01);box-shadow:0 8px 20px rgba(168,175,208,.5);cursor:pointer}.card__title{width:50%;font-family:Gotham Medium;font-size:22px;font-weight:500}.card__description,.card__title{margin-bottom:32px;color:#36486a}.card__description{width:58%;font-size:18px}.card_web-development{background-image:url(/_next/static/media/web_development_card.6a181990.svg)}.card_outstuffing{background-image:url(/_next/static/media/outstuffing.d3111954.svg)}.card_ai-integration{background-image:url(/_next/static/media/ai_integration_card.78cc559e.svg)}.card_mobile-development{background-image:url(/_next/static/media/mobile_development.96cfc969.svg)}.card_design-card{background-image:url(/_next/static/media/design_card.c79bef45.svg)}@media screen and (max-width:1120px){.card__title{margin-bottom:24px}.card__description{margin-bottom:24px;font-size:16px}}@media screen and (max-width:992px){.card{padding:20px 0 20px 20px}.card__description,.card__title{width:60%}}@media screen and (max-width:768px){.card{padding:32px;flex-wrap:wrap}.card__description,.card__title{width:100%}}@media screen and (max-width:576px){.card{min-height:132px;flex-wrap:wrap;justify-content:flex-start}.card__title{font-size:18px;width:75%}.card__description{width:60%;font-size:16px}.card_web-development{background-image:url(/_next/static/media/web_development_card_small.7bb6a5d8.svg)}.card_outstuffing{background-image:url(/_next/static/media/outstuffing_small.aea793ad.svg)}.card_ai-integration{background-image:url(/_next/static/media/ai_integration_card_small.453af876.svg)}.card_mobile-development{background-image:url(/_next/static/media/mobile_development_small.69ed674a.svg)}.card_design-card{background-image:url(/_next/static/media/design_card_small.defd3d0d.svg)}}@media screen and (max-width:420px){.card{padding:24px}.card__title{font-size:14px;width:50%}.card__description{width:75%;font-size:12px}}.card-link{display:none;padding-right:32px}.card-link__title{width:85%}@media screen and (min-width:576px)and (max-width:992px){.card-link{display:block}}.services-block{margin-bottom:64px}.services-block__row{justify-content:space-between}.services-block__row:not(:last-child){margin-bottom:28px}.services-block__card_big{width:49%;background-position:100% 100%;background-size:contain;background-repeat:no-repeat}.services-block__card_small{width:32%;background-position:105% 55%;background-size:50%;background-repeat:no-repeat}@media screen and (max-width:992px){.services-block__row{flex-wrap:wrap}.services-block__card_big{width:49%}.services-block__card_small{width:49%;background-size:70%;margin-bottom:28px}}@media screen and (max-width:576px){.services-block__card_big{width:100%;height:302px;margin-bottom:18px;background-size:cover}.services-block__row:not(:last-child){margin-bottom:0}.services-block__card_small{width:100%;margin-bottom:18px;background-size:cover}.services-block__card_small:last-child{margin-top:0;margin-bottom:0}}.work-examples-block{margin:0 auto 64px}.work-examples-block__title{width:100%;margin:0 auto 45px}.work-examples-block__slider{position:relative;margin-bottom:64px}.work-examples-block__shadow-wrapper{position:absolute;top:0;left:50%;width:100%;max-width:100vw;height:100%;-webkit-transform:translateX(-50%);box-shadow:none;transform:translateX(-50%);padding:0 70px;z-index:2;pointer-events:none}.work-examples-block__ai-card{color:#36486a!important;background-image:url(/_next/static/media/ai_card.bb24ac08.svg);background-size:cover}.work-examples-block__html-designer-card{background-color:#000223;background-image:url(/_next/static/media/html_designer_card.12a703d5.svg);background-size:cover}.work-examples-block__maxa-editor-card{display:flex;flex-direction:column;align-items:center!important;background-image:url(/_next/static/media/maxa_editor.f3183482.svg),linear-gradient(90deg,rgb(131,226,252),rgb(96,175,255));background-size:cover}.work-examples-block__amp-card{background-image:url(/_next/static/media/amp_card.b3ad2631.svg),linear-gradient(90deg,rgb(131,226,252),rgb(96,175,255));background-size:cover}.work-examples-block__ai-light-card{color:#000;background-image:url(/_next/static/media/ai-day-nigth.2aaf90a5.svg);background-size:cover}.work-examples-block__online-chat-card{color:#000;background-image:url(/_next/static/media/online-chat.a7e93f1d.svg);background-size:cover}.work-examples-block__ai-gmail-card{color:#000;background-image:url(/_next/static/media/ai-gmail.63e60dd6.svg);background-size:cover}.work-examples-block__pagination{display:flex;justify-content:center;height:16px;margin-top:32px}.work-examples-block__feedback{display:flex;flex-direction:column;justify-content:center;align-items:center;max-width:1240px;width:100%;margin:0 auto 45px;height:168px;padding:32px 0;background:linear-gradient(90deg,rgba(0,125,255,.5),rgba(96,175,255,.5),rgba(0,125,255,.5)),url(/_next/static/media/feedback.672e489c.svg);background-position:50%;border-radius:20px}.work-examples-block__feedback-title{margin-bottom:16px;color:#fff;font-size:26px;font-weight:500;text-align:center}.work-examples-block .swiper-slide-active{z-index:10;transition:all .3s ease-in}@media screen and (max-width:1730px){.work-examples-block__shadow-wrapper{box-shadow:inset 200px 0 110px -70px #fff,inset -200px 0 110px -70px #fff}}@media screen and (max-width:1240px){.work-examples-block__shadow-wrapper{box-shadow:inset 140px 0 60px -70px #fff,inset -140px 0 60px -70px #fff}}@media screen and (max-width:768px){.work-examples-block__slider{margin-bottom:32px}.work-examples-block__maxa-editor-card{padding:32px 36px}.work-examples-block__feedback{padding:16px 0;height:auto}.work-examples-block__feedback-title{margin-bottom:12px;padding:0 12px;font-size:22px;font-weight:500}.work-examples-block__shadow-wrapper{box-shadow:none}}@media screen and (max-width:576px){.work-examples-block__feedback{background:url(/_next/static/media/feedback_small.edc13780.svg);background-size:cover}.work-examples-block__feedback-title{font-size:16px}}@media screen and (max-width:420px){.work-examples-block__title{width:100%;margin:0 auto 32px}.work-examples-block__maxa-editor-card .work-examples-block__card-title{font-size:28px}}.technologies-block__title{max-width:1320px;width:100%;margin:0 auto;padding:0 40px;color:#36486a;font-family:Gotham Medium;font-size:26px;font-weight:500}.technologies-block__graph-wrapper{margin:0 20%;height:1200px}@media screen and (max-width:1640px){.technologies-block__graph-wrapper{margin:0 15%;height:900px}}@media screen and (max-width:1200px){.technologies-block__graph-wrapper{margin:0 10%;height:740px}}@media screen and (max-width:768px){.technologies-block__graph-wrapper{margin:0 5%;height:700px}}@media screen and (max-width:700px){.technologies-block__graph-wrapper{margin:0 5%;height:1240px}}@media screen and (max-width:576px){.technologies-block__title{font-size:24px;line-height:28px;margin-bottom:24px}}.technologies-block .react-flow__panel{display:none}